# Per-Module i18n with Gettext

**Translate sidebar tab labels, group labels, and tooltips inside your PhoenixKit module.**

This guide shows how each PhoenixKit module owns its own Gettext backend, ships its own `.po` files, and registers admin/settings/dashboard tabs with `gettext_backend:` so labels translate at render time according to the user's locale. Applies to **every** module that exposes UI — both new modules being authored from day 1 and existing modules being uplifted to the PhoenixKit release that introduces the `gettext_backend` / `gettext_domain` API. ## What core gives you

Starting with the PhoenixKit release that introduces this API (see CHANGELOG for the exact version), `PhoenixKit.Dashboard.Tab` and `PhoenixKit.Dashboard.Group` accept two optional fields:

| Field | Type | Default | Purpose |
|-------|------|---------|---------|
| `gettext_backend` | `module()` or `nil` | `nil` | Module that owns the Gettext catalogue for this tab/group. `nil` keeps the raw label. |
| `gettext_domain` | `String.t()` | `"default"` | Gettext domain to look the msgid up in. |

Sidebar / `AdminSidebar` / `TabItem` components automatically route every label and tooltip render through:

- `Tab.localized_label/1`
- `Tab.localized_tooltip/1`
- `Group.localized_label/1`

Each helper:

1. Returns `nil` if the underlying field (`label` / `tooltip`) is `nil` — divider tabs and unlabeled groups stay safe.
2. Returns the raw string if `gettext_backend` is `nil` — backwards compatible.
3. Otherwise calls `Gettext.dgettext(backend, domain, msgid)` against the **process locale** of the LiveView. Locale is set per request by the parent app's locale plug or on-mount hook. **Modules must not set the locale themselves.**

---

## Why each module owns its own backend

When a module ships as a separate Hex package, it cannot rely on the parent application's `PhoenixKitWeb.Gettext` — that backend belongs to the core library, not to your package. Each module ships its own `.po` files in its own `priv/gettext/` and registers translations with `gettext_backend: PhoenixKit<X>.Gettext`. The parent app sets the user's locale once per request; every module's backend then independently looks up its own msgids in its own catalogue.

This also matches the `dynamic_children/2` callback contract: arity-2 dynamic-children functions already receive the current locale, but using `gettext_backend:` on returned `%Tab{}` structs is more declarative and avoids manual `Gettext.put_locale/2` juggling.

## Step-by-step setup

### A. Create the Gettext backend

```elixir
# lib/phoenix_kit_<x>/gettext.ex
defmodule PhoenixKit<X>.Gettext do
  @moduledoc """
  Gettext backend for phoenix_kit_<x>.

  Locale is set per-request by the parent application; this module's only
  responsibility is owning the catalogues under `priv/gettext/`.
  """
  use Gettext.Backend, otp_app: :phoenix_kit_<x>
end
```

`use Gettext.Backend, otp_app: ...` is the **`Gettext 0.26+` form**. The older `use Gettext, otp_app: ...` style is deprecated; do not use it.

### B. `mix.exs`

```elixir
def application do
  [
    extra_applications: [:logger, :gettext]   # :gettext is required at runtime
  ]
end

defp deps do
  [
    # Use the version that introduces the gettext_backend API
    # — check PhoenixKit's CHANGELOG for the exact minimum.
    {:phoenix_kit, "~> X.Y"},
    {:gettext, "~> 1.0"}
  ]
end
```

### C. Switch existing `use Gettext` calls

Find every file in your module that currently uses the parent app's backend:

```bash
grep -rl "PhoenixKitWeb.Gettext" lib/
```

Replace:

```elixir
# Before
use Gettext, backend: PhoenixKitWeb.Gettext

# After
use Gettext, backend: PhoenixKit<X>.Gettext
```

This is mandatory before `hex.publish` — your published package must not reference the parent app's backend.

### D. Wire your tabs and groups

Every `%Tab{}` and `%Group{}` registered by your module's `admin_tabs/0`, `settings_tabs/0`, `user_dashboard_tabs/0`, or `dynamic_children/2` callback must carry the backend:

```elixir
@impl PhoenixKit.Module
def admin_tabs do
  [
    Tab.new!(
      id: :admin_projects,
      label: "Projects",
      icon: "hero-folder",
      path: "projects",
      priority: 400,
      level: :admin,
      permission: "projects",
      group: :admin_modules,
      gettext_backend: PhoenixKit<X>.Gettext,
      gettext_domain: "default"     # optional — "default" is the default
    ),
    Tab.new!(
      id: :admin_projects_new,
      label: "New Project",
      path: "projects/new",
      priority: 410,
      level: :admin,
      permission: "projects",
      parent: :admin_projects,
      gettext_backend: PhoenixKit<X>.Gettext
    )
  ]
end
```

Groups, when your module contributes them:

```elixir
%Group{
  id: :projects_section,
  label: "Project management",
  priority: 400,
  collapsible: true,
  gettext_backend: PhoenixKit<X>.Gettext
}
```

### E. `dynamic_children/2` — locale-aware children

If your tab uses `dynamic_children:` to render child tabs at runtime (e.g. one tab per project), implement the **arity-2** form. Children only need the backend set on items whose labels are msgids; user-supplied data stays raw:

```elixir
%Tab{
  id: :admin_projects,
  label: "Projects",
  # ... other fields ...
  dynamic_children: fn _scope, _locale ->
    PhoenixKit.RepoHelper.repo().all(Project)
    |> Enum.map(fn project ->
      %Tab{
        id: :"admin_project_#{project.id}",
        label: project.name,        # raw user-supplied — no translation needed
        path: "projects/#{project.id}",
        parent: :admin_projects,
        level: :admin,
        permission: "projects"
        # gettext_backend NOT set — project names are user data, not msgids
      }
    end)
  end
}
```

> **Rule of thumb:** set `gettext_backend:` only when `label`/`tooltip` is a fixed English msgid that lives in your `.po` files. User-supplied content (project names, document titles, customer names) stays raw.

### F. Dividers and group headers

`Tab.divider/1` and `Tab.group_header/1` accept the same options:

```elixir
Tab.divider(
  priority: 150,
  label: "Account",
  gettext_backend: PhoenixKit<X>.Gettext
)

Tab.group_header(
  id: :reports_header,
  label: "Reports",
  priority: 500,
  gettext_backend: PhoenixKit<X>.Gettext
)
```

### G. Tooltips

Tooltips translate via the same backend automatically — set `tooltip:` to the msgid alongside `gettext_backend:` and the sidebar's `title=` attribute will render the translated text:

```elixir
Tab.new!(
  id: :admin_projects,
  label: "Projects",
  tooltip: "Manage all projects",   # msgid for tooltip translation
  path: "projects",
  gettext_backend: PhoenixKit<X>.Gettext
)
```

### H. Extract msgids and fill translations

```bash
# Generate / update the .pot (template)
mix gettext.extract

# Merge new msgids into each locale's .po
mix gettext.merge priv/gettext --locale en
mix gettext.merge priv/gettext --locale ru
mix gettext.merge priv/gettext --locale et
```

Edit `priv/gettext/<locale>/LC_MESSAGES/default.po`:

```po
#: lib/phoenix_kit_<x>/<x>.ex
msgid "Projects"
msgstr "Проекты"

#: lib/phoenix_kit_<x>/<x>.ex
msgid "New Project"
msgstr "Новый проект"

#: lib/phoenix_kit_<x>/<x>.ex
msgid "Manage all projects"
msgstr "Управление всеми проектами"
```

For `en`: `msgstr` should equal `msgid` (gettext's "no translation needed" convention; without it, gettext returns the empty string for `en` and your label disappears).

## Hex package shape

`mix.exs` `package files:` **must include `priv`**. The directory is otherwise excluded from the Hex tarball, so the new `.po` files would not ship and `Gettext.dgettext/3` would silently return raw msgids in production for every consumer that installed from Hex.

```elixir
defp package do
  [
    licenses: ["MIT"],
    links: %{"GitHub" => @source_url},
    files: ~w(lib priv .formatter.exs mix.exs README.md CHANGELOG.md LICENSE)
    #         ^^^^ this
  ]
end
```

Verify locally with:

```bash
mix hex.build
tar -tzf phoenix_kit_<x>-*.tar | grep priv/gettext
# should list every .po and .pot file
```

---

## Conditional CI skip

The `gettext_backend` API was introduced by [PR #522](https://github.com/BeamLabEU/phoenix_kit/pull/522) on `phoenix_kit` core. Until the consumer's `phoenix_kit` dep resolves to a published release that includes it, `PhoenixKit.Dashboard.Tab.localized_label/1` does not exist and the i18n smoke test would raise `UndefinedFunctionError`. To keep CI green on consumers who haven't yet upgraded, gate the smoke test with a `:requires_phoenix_kit_i18n_api` tag and detect availability in `test_helper.exs`:

```elixir
# test/test_helper.exs
require Logger

if Code.ensure_loaded?(PhoenixKit.Dashboard.Tab) and
     function_exported?(PhoenixKit.Dashboard.Tab, :localized_label, 1) do
  ExUnit.start()
else
  Logger.info(
    "[test_helper] PhoenixKit.Dashboard.Tab.localized_label/1 not available — " <>
      "i18n tests excluded. They will run automatically once `phoenix_kit` is " <>
      "upgraded to a release that ships the gettext_backend API."
  )

  ExUnit.start(exclude: [:requires_phoenix_kit_i18n_api])
end
```

```elixir
# test/phoenix_kit/<x>/i18n_test.exs
defmodule PhoenixKit.<X>.I18nTest do
  use ExUnit.Case, async: false

  @moduletag :requires_phoenix_kit_i18n_api

  # ...
end
```

`Code.ensure_loaded?/1` is load-bearing — without it, `function_exported?/3` returns `false` if the `Tab` module hasn't been loaded yet at helper-init time, and the i18n tests get excluded even when the API is available.

## Test pattern

A single smoke test per module is sufficient — core's tests already cover the localization machinery itself:

```elixir
defmodule PhoenixKit<X>.I18nSmokeTest do
  use ExUnit.Case, async: false

  # Excluded by `test/test_helper.exs` when running against a `phoenix_kit`
  # release that pre-dates the `gettext_backend` API. Once the consumer
  # upgrades, the helper detects it and these tests run automatically.
  @moduletag :requires_phoenix_kit_i18n_api

  alias PhoenixKit.Dashboard.Tab

  setup do
    original = Gettext.get_locale(PhoenixKit<X>.Gettext)
    on_exit(fn -> Gettext.put_locale(PhoenixKit<X>.Gettext, original) end)
    :ok
  end

  test "admin tab labels translate to ru" do
    Gettext.put_locale(PhoenixKit<X>.Gettext, "ru")

    [tab | _] = PhoenixKit<X>.admin_tabs()

    # Replace with the actual translation you put in ru/default.po
    assert Tab.localized_label(tab) == "Проекты"
  end

  test "admin tab labels fall back to msgid for an unknown locale" do
    Gettext.put_locale(PhoenixKit<X>.Gettext, "xx")

    [tab | _] = PhoenixKit<X>.admin_tabs()
    assert Tab.localized_label(tab) == tab.label
  end
end
```

`async: false` is required because `Gettext.put_locale/2` mutates the calling process's process dictionary; `on_exit` restores it cleanly. Pair this module with the conditional helper from [§ Conditional CI skip](#conditional-ci-skip).

---

## Common pitfalls

❌ **Do NOT** call `Gettext.put_locale/2` from inside your module — locale is a request-scoped concern owned by the parent app.

❌ **Do NOT** translate before passing to PhoenixKit core APIs that persist data. For example, `Tab.label` is the source of the row label that `Permissions.register_custom_key/2` writes to the database. Translating it before registration would corrupt the canonical key store. Pass the raw msgid; rendering localizes.

❌ **Do NOT** invent a custom domain unless you actually have multiple. `"default"` is the convention; switch to a domain-per-area only when one `default.po` becomes too noisy.

❌ **Do NOT** keep `use Gettext, backend: PhoenixKitWeb.Gettext` in published code. That backend belongs to PhoenixKit core and won't be mounted in every consumer app the same way.

❌ **Do NOT** set `gettext_backend:` on dynamically-generated user-data labels (project names, document titles). These are not msgids; gettext would return the raw string anyway, but the field still wastes a Gettext call per render.

❌ **Do NOT** ship without `mix gettext.extract --merge` — stale `.pot` means newly added msgids never reach `.po` and translators have nothing to translate.

❌ **Do NOT** pattern-match on `gettext_backend` / `gettext_domain` from a generic Tab handler. The library's resolvers (`Tab.localized_label/1` etc.) deliberately use `Map.get/2` so old-shape Tab structs cached in ETS or `:persistent_term` from before the upgrade — missing both new keys — flow through gracefully instead of raising `KeyError`. If you write your own iteration over `PhoenixKit.ModuleRegistry.all_admin_tabs/0`, prefer `Tab.localized_label/1` over reaching into the struct directly. This matters during the rolling-upgrade window where a parent app's Phoenix server keeps running across the `phoenix_kit` upgrade.
